Abstract
The invention discloses a method for improving stability of outlet moisture of a stem moistening machine in a stub bar stage. The method comprises the following steps: 1) determining a stub bar water addition amount: when production reaches a stable state, measuring loosing and rewetting outlet moisture and calculating an outlet moisture deviation, and after the outlet moisture deviation is less than a set deviation and a set time lastingly, calculating the average a of loosing and rewetting water addition flow within the set time; and 2) segmentally adding water into stub bars. Through training of the stub bar water addition amount, a water addition amount which can be used as a basis is found, and water addition amounts in different stages of the stub bars are determined by a linear approximation method, and thus quantified, so that a basis for reasonably regulating the water addition amounts is provided, and the stability of the outlet moisture in the stub bar stage is improved.

Background technology
What terrier operation adopted is scraper type offal moisture regaining machine, and for obstructing line offal pretreatment section, object is to increase offal temperatureDegree, makes the offal moisture regain of further heating, and offal is steamed thoroughly, and the overall flexibility of raising offal, is the further processing of offalCondition is provided. Moisture content of outlet is the key index of terrier operation.
What moisture content of outlet adopted is FEEDBACK CONTROL, removes to adjust in real time amount of water according to the detected value of Moisture Meter. Initial in productionIn the stage, smoked sheet is after loosening and gaining moisture processing, and moisture content need be through being just controlled in the scope of standard-required after a while, thisIndividual process is called stub bar. The stub bar stage is the difficult point of controlling, and because of the moisture value that outlet material cannot be detected in this class, makesMust not adjust the foundation of amount of water, tend to occur relatively large deviation at stub bar stage moisture value, when Moisture Meter can detectWhile adjustment again after its moisture content of outlet, there is larger vibration. And also do not have at present effective method to address this problem.

A method that improves terrier machine stub bar stage moisture content of outlet stability, comprises the steps:
1) determining of stub bar amount of water: in the time that production enters stable state, measure loosening and gaining moisture moisture content of outlet, and calculate outletThe deviation of moisture, sets after the deviation setting time when moisture content of outlet deviation continues to be less than, and calculates loosening and gaining moisture in this setting-up timeThe mean value a that adds discharge;
2) stub bar is carried out to segmentation and add water, in the time that tobacco leaf cumulative amount is A, loosening and gaining moisture amount of water is b*a, when A is less than etc.In setting value, when c, this setting value is the accumulative total inventory in the time that exit has mass transport out, and b is less than or equal to 1 and be greater thanEqual 0, A less, b is less, and b is for adding water coefficient.
Preferably, in the time that A is greater than setting value c, adds discharge and adopt FEEDBACK CONTROL. In the time that A is greater than c, exitThere is mass transport out, at this time can, by detecting material moisture, control the feeding quantity of loosening and gaining moisture, made to regulate moreAdd flexibly.
Preferably, step 1) in, produce enter the stabilization sub stage be while being greater than 1000kg taking the tobacco leaf cumulative amount of loosening and gaining moisture asAccurate.
From knowhow, in the time that the cumulative amount of tobacco leaf reaches 1000kg, produce and entered the stabilization sub stage, only have when rawWhen product enters the stabilization sub stage, the amount of water of loosening and gaining moisture is just in stable state, if the deviation of the moisture of outlet material is stableIn a low scope, represent that material moisture tends towards stability, loosening and gaining moisture addition now can be used as standard, as follow-upThe reference of producing.
Preferably, step 1) in, the setting value of moisture content of outlet deviation is 0.8-1.3%, lasting setting-up time is 10-20min.
Further preferred, step 1) in, the setting value of moisture content of outlet deviation is 1%, lasting setting-up time is 10min.
Preferably, when the cumulative amount of tobacco leaf is greater than after 350kg, exit starts to have mass transport out.
Further preferred, step 2) in, in the time that tobacco leaf cumulative amount is 0≤A≤100kg, b is 0, relies in damping machineSteam carry out loosening and gaining moisture;
In the time that tobacco leaf cumulative amount is 100 < A≤150kg, b is 0.2;
In the time that tobacco leaf cumulative amount is 150 < A≤200kg, b is 0.5;
In the time that tobacco leaf cumulative amount is 200 < A≤250kg, b is 0.8;
In the time that tobacco leaf cumulative amount is 250 < A≤350kg, b is 1.
